Convertire Delphi Bitwise Operazione da Cobol
-
13-09-2019 - |
Domanda
Come può questo codice venga convertito in COBOL?
Result := GetSysColor(Color and $000000FF)
I tipi di valore sono DWORD, credo che sia un'operazione bit per bit.
Soluzione
Sì, è un'operazione bit per bit, tuttavia, questa particolare operazione è equivalente a
COMPUTE Result = Color mod 256.
o
COMPUTE Result = MOD(Color, 256).
Se non ricordo male il mio COBOL. E 'stato decenni anni da quando ho Worte una linea di COBOL.
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ow